Recently, a SUSA poll in GA showed McCain at 52% and Obama at 44%. In a matter of weeks Obama was able to jump 8 points! Now I can confirm that this poll is not a fluke.
Today, Insider Advantage(a GA based polling company) released a poll showing McCain at 50% and Obama at 44%. Keep in mind that these polls do not include newly registered voters, which are expected to go heavily for Obama and Jim Martin.
Plus, African-American turnout in GA has skyrocketed! Nearly 40% of people who have voted early in GA are African-Americans. Traditionally, African-American voter turnout in GA has been far lower.
In short, we still have a fighting chance to win GA's 15 electoral votes.
